Cancellation steps

  1. 1

    On a web browser (not the app), go to substack.com/settings/subscriptions to see every publication you pay for

  2. 2

    Click the publication you want to cancel → scroll to Account actions → "To cancel your paid subscription, click here"

  3. 3

    Click Cancel Subscription — you'll get a confirmation email, and paid access continues until the end of the current billing cycle, then reverts to the free tier

What should I watch out for when cancelling Substack?

Substack bills each newsletter separately, so cancelling one doesn't touch the others — cancel each paid publication on its own. Subscribed inside the Substack iOS app instead of on the web? You must cancel through the App Store (profile picture → Settings → Payments → the publication), because Apple handles that billing. Annual plans auto-refund only within 7 days of payment (and only if you haven't claimed a subscriber perk); after that a refund is the writer's call. Just need a break? The same screen offers Pause instead of Cancel.
